#cd9ec5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d9ec5 is composed of 80.4% red, 62%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 310.2 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 71.2%. #cd9ec5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9b3d8b.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#cd9ec5 color description : Grayish magenta.
#cd9ec5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d9ec5 has RGB values of R:205, G:158,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.04,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13475525.
